So I did a vehicle “re-boot”, hood closed, went into relearn. It seemed to work better, first 3 wheels registered with just one beep and the light moving to the proper corner. But it is hanging up on the left rear. Seems like that sensor is dead. But I still can’t seem to exit the relearn without turning the key off and it refuses to register the 3 good wheels that are working.

So I did a vehicle “re-boot”, hood closed, went into relearn. It seemed to work better, first 3 wheels registered with just one beep and the light moving to the proper corner. But it is hanging up on the left rear. Seems like that sensor is dead. But I still can’t seem to exit the relearn without turning the key off and it refuses to register the 3 good wheels that are working.
when you put it in learn if it does not learn all 4 then it will not finish the learn and will time out, it wont learn less then 4

I bought new Michelins from Costco couple months ago and paid the extra $180ish for them to replace all 4 tire sensors ( all were 16yo and had not worked for a few years )
They could not sync up the 4 new sensors and after 2 trips up there to the Costco tire shop i told them just remove them and give me my $180 back.

Now I have a constant message of tire sensor on my dash ( like before ) Wish there was a way to permanent remove the message.
I can old school check my tire pressure with a handheld gauge like I have done 1000 times in my life
A BT Dieselworks AutoSync Bluetooth dongle will give you the option to disable the TPMS system. When disabled it keeps the light and the "service tire monitor system" warning from coming on and when you scroll to the tire pressures on the DIC it just shows - - for each pressure.

It does many other things also. The TPMS disabling is just one.
